Conversion Formula for Cubic Centimeter Per Hour to Milliliter Per Second
Conversion from cubic centimeter per hour to milliliter per second is a simple process once you know the basic relationship between the two units. One Cubic Centimeter Per Hour is equal to 0.0002777778 Milliliter Per Second, while one Milliliter Per Second contains 3,600 Cubic Centimeter Per Hour.
To change a measurement from cubic centimeter per hour to milliliter per second, you only need to multiply the number of cubic centimeter per hour by 0.0002777778.
1 Cubic Centimeter Per Hour = 0.0002777778 Milliliter Per Second
1 Milliliter Per Second = 3,600 Cubic Centimeter Per Hour
This gives you the equivalent value in milliliter per second quickly and accurately. By using this straightforward formula, you can easily switch between these units whenever needed.

Cubic Centimeter per Hour
Introduction : Measuring minute flows over an hour, this unit is useful for extremely slow transfer systems.
History & Origin : Introduced for applications where flow is nearly imperceptible but must be tracked accurately.
Current Use : Ideal in precision dosing, long-term chemical reactions, and fuel cells.
Milliliter per Second
Introduction : This unit captures the flow of one-thousandth of a liter per second — ideal for lab-scale flow monitoring.
History & Origin : Evolved as a common metric in chemical dosing and syringe-based medical devices.
Current Use : Found in infusion devices, analytical instruments, and inkjet systems.

FAQ on Cubic Centimeter Per Hour to Milliliter Per Second Conversion:
What are the standard abbreviation or symbols for cubic centimeter per hour and milliliter per second?
The standard abbreviation for cubic centimeter per hour is “cm³/h”, while milliliter per second is abbreviated as “mL/s.” These symbols are commonly used to represent units of common flow rate in both everyday contexts and technical measurements.
What is the process of conversion from cubic centimeter per hour to milliliter per second units?
For conversion from cubic centimeter per hour to milliliter per second, multiply the number of cubic centimeter per hour by 0.00027777777777778 as one cubic centimeter per hour equals 0.00027777777777778 milliliter per second.
Formula: No of milliliter per second = No of cubic centimeter per hour × 0.00027777777777778
This is the standard method used for conversion between these units of common flow rate.
How do you convert milliliter per second to cubic centimeter per hour?
To convert milliliter per second to cubic centimeter per hour, multiply the number of milliliter per second by 3600 as one milliliter per second equals 3600 cubic centimeter per hour.
Formula: No of cubic centimeter per hour = No of milliliter per second × 3600
